网站设计基础:textarea元素与网页构成

需积分: 15 15 下载量 186 浏览量 更新于2024-08-22 收藏 858KB PPT 举报
"该资源是一本关于网站建设的实用教程,由陈明编著,作为普通高等教育“十一五”国家级规划教材。书中涵盖了网站设计基础、HTML、CSS和JavaScript基础、ASP.NET基础、数据库基础与ADO.NET、远程教育系统实例、Web服务器和数据库服务器以及网站安全和优化等内容。在网站设计基础部分,讲解了网站的相关知识,包括网站的分类、主页与网页的区别、网页的组成元素,以及网站的规划和设计,强调了明确内容、抓住用户和快速下载等设计技巧。" 在网站建设中,`textarea`元素是用于创建多行多列输入的文本区域,常用于收集用户的大段文字信息。它允许用户输入多行文本,相比于单行的`input`元素,`textarea`更适合长篇内容的填写。`textarea`的几个关键属性包括: 1. **Name**: 这个属性定义了在表单提交时该元素的名称,用于标识用户输入的数据。 2. **Value**: 设置或获取`textarea`元素的初始内容,即用户在页面加载时看到的文本。 3. **Default value**: 指定元素的默认文本,即当页面加载时显示的文本。 `textarea`还支持一些方法来控制其行为: - **blur()**: 使`textarea`失去焦点,取消当前选中的状态。 - **select()**: 高亮显示`textarea`中的所有文本。 同时,`textarea`也响应特定的事件: - **onBlur**: 当用户将焦点从`textarea`移开时触发。 - **onFocus**: 用户将焦点置于`textarea`上时触发。 - **onchange**: 文本区域内容发生改变并失去焦点后触发。 - **onselect**: 用户选取了`textarea`中的文本时触发。 网站建设不仅仅是技术实现,还包括规划和设计阶段。在规划阶段,需要明确网站的目标、类型、主题内容、风格、网页结构和内容,以及考虑数据库定制和技术实施。在设计阶段,要注重网站的CI形象、栏目设置、目录和链接结构,同时运用各种设计技巧,如清晰的内容表达、吸引用户的界面、快速加载速度、网站地图、错误检查、合适的布局和谨慎使用多媒体元素,以提升用户体验。常见的网页布局形式有"T"形、"口"形、"三"形和对称对比布局,每种都有其独特的展示效果和适用场景。